The 25th-ranked LSU Tigers return to the gridiron on Saturday evening, will they play host to the Syracuse Orange in non-conference action.

The contest, which will be televised on ESPN2, will mark the second home game of the year for LSU.

LSU, who dropped their SEC opener on Saturday, falling to Mississippi St., 37-7, is 2-1, overall, and 0-1 in league play.

Offensively, the Tigers are scoring at an average of 26.3 points-per-game, while accumulating 401.0 yards of offense, including 217.0 rushing yards and 184.0 passing yards.

Defensively, LSU is holding opponents to an average of 15.7 points a contest, to go along with 268.0 total yards, including 152.0 pass yards, and 116.0 rush yards.

LSU is paced by quarterback Danny Etling, who has completed 35-of-60 passes for 535 yards and one touchdown, and running back Derrius Guice, who has rushed 300 yards and 4 touchdowns, on 57 attempts.

Syracuse defeated Central Michigan last week, 47-17, to improve to 2-1 on the year.

Offensively, the Orange have scored an average of 38.0 points per game, to go along with 491.0 yards of offense, including 193.7 rush yards and 297.3 passing yards.

Defensively, Syracuse has allowed an average of 18.0 points, to go along with 304.0 total yards, including 84.3 rush yards and 219.7 pass yards.

The Orange are led by quarterback Eric Dungey, who has thrown for 787 yards and 5 touchdowns, while rushing for another 209 yards and 4 scores.

This will be the 4th meeting between the two schools, with LSU leading the all-time series, 2-1.

LSU won the last meeting, 34-24, back in 2015.

Kickoff time at Tiger Stadium is scheduled for just after 6 pm.
